Born in the backrooms of half-lit bars and whiskey-soaked motels, Hellwater Saints rose from the ashes of heartbreak, hard labor, and outlaw grace.
No one really knows when the band began — only that one night, under the hum of a flickering neon cross, a deep gravel voice started singing over a broken slide guitar… and the ghosts listened.

At its core, Hellwater Saints is a restless soul that shifts between one and two voices — sometimes a lone preacher of fire and dust, other times a duet of sin and salvation.
The male vocal brings the grit — whiskey, iron, and confession.
The female voice brings the flame — soul, smoke, and redemption.
Together they sound like thunder and prayer colliding in the desert.

Their songs are Southern Gothic hymns for the working man and the lost lover — dark country tales of faith, betrayal, whiskey, and the long road home.
Each performance is a sermon with scars, where guitars weep and the air tastes of smoke and steel.

Hellwater Saints don’t chase fame.
They chase truth — and the fire that burns between heaven and hell.
